List of Top 25 Power 5 schools all-sports national titles ranking (non-football)
Posted on 1/26/20 at 3:56 pm
Posted on 1/26/20 at 3:56 pm
This includes all official NCAA-sanctioned sports other than football. SEC schools are in bold caps.
**EDIT: These are all TEAM titles; individual titles not counted here.
#1. Stanford - 122
#2. UCLA - 119
#3. Southern California - 106
#4. ARKANSAS, Oklahoma State - 49
#6. Texas, Penn. State - 48
#8. North Carolina - 45
#9. LSU - 43
#10. California - 38
#11. GEORGIA - 37
#12. FLORIDA - 36
#13. Michigan - 34
#14. Oregon - 33
#15. Maryland, Ohio State, Oklahoma - 30
#18. Colorado - 27
#19. Virginia - 26
#20. Iowa - 25
#21. Arizona State, Indiana - 24
#23. Connecticut, Utah - 22
#24. AUBURN, Nebraska - 20
Other SEC schools....
TEXAS A&M, TENNESSEE - 16
ALABAMA - 12
KENTUCKY - 11
SOUTH CAROLINA - 7
VANDERBILT - 5
MISSOURI - 2
OLE MISS, MISSISSIPPI STATE - 0
